Eligibility and Requirements

Berenson's sample program has specific eligibility requirements that potential participants should be aware of:

  • Industry professionals must have a registered account on the Berenson website to place sample requests
  • Designers and dealers can request free samples for customers by email
  • All sample recipients must have a mail receptacle at the provided address to receive packages
  • The program is available to both trade professionals and individual consumers

Sample Limitations and Specifications

The free samples offered through Berenson's program come with certain restrictions:

  • Customers can order up to five free decorative hardware samples
  • Samples are limited to Berenson and Advantage Plus by Berenson knobs and pulls of 160mm CC or less
  • Free shipping is included with all samples, which are shipped via USPS mail

For products outside these parameters, Berenson offers alternative sampling options:

  • Longer lengths and R. Christensen by Berenson hardware can be ordered as samples at 50% off MSRP with paid flat rate shipping ($4 per part)
  • Hooks, latches, and appliance pulls are not available as samples
  • It's important to note that sample parts are not intended for display purposes

Sampling Options

Plank Hardware offers three distinct sampling options:

  1. Finish Swatches: This option provides a handy set of core cabinet hardware finishes that can be attached to keys. The swatches allow users to explore and create cohesive design schemes at any time and in any location. The portability of this option makes it particularly valuable for design professionals who need to reference finishes during client meetings or while on-site.

  2. Custom 3-Piece Pack: This option allows users to select three unique hardware samples free of charge. To build this pack, users select "Order a sample" on product pages. The pack includes knobs and pulls only, excluding heavyweight and closet bar pulls. While the samples themselves are free, customers are responsible for paying shipping costs.

  3. Compact Display Board: Designed for those who are often on the move, this option features a compact display board that fits into a box. This presentation format is ideal for trade shows, client presentations, or designers who need to transport samples efficiently.

Comparative Analysis of Sample Programs

While both Berenson Hardware and Plank Hardware offer valuable sample programs, they differ in their approach and offerings:

Sample Quantity and Variety

  • Berenson offers up to five free samples per request
  • Plank's Custom 3-Piece Pack provides exactly three free samples
  • Both companies limit their free samples to specific product types (knobs and pulls of certain sizes)

Shipping Policies

  • Berenson includes free shipping for all free samples
  • Plank requires customers to pay shipping costs for their free samples
  • Berenson specifies shipping via USPS mail; Plank does not specify the shipping method

Target Audience

  • Berenson's program appears more accessible to individual consumers, though it also serves industry professionals
  • Plank's program seems more tailored to design professionals, with options like the keychain swatches and compact display board that cater to mobile professionals

Product Exclusions

  • Both companies exclude certain product types from their free sample programs
  • Berenson specifically excludes hooks, latches, and appliance pulls
  • Plank excludes heavyweight and closet bar pulls from their 3-Piece Pack option

Practical Considerations for Sample Requestors

When utilizing cabinet hardware sample programs, there are several practical considerations that can enhance the experience:

Planning Sample Requests

  • Consider ordering samples from multiple brands to compare options
  • Select samples that represent the different finishes and styles you're considering
  • Take into account the sample limitations when planning your requests

Evaluating Samples

  • Test samples in the actual lighting conditions of your space
  • Consider how the samples look with your cabinetry and other design elements
  • Evaluate the feel and functionality of different hardware types

Documentation

  • Keep records of which samples correspond to which products
  • Note the product numbers and finishes for easy reference when placing orders
  • Take photos of installed samples in your space for future reference
